The Estimation Problem: Why Margin Dies at the Desk
Let's look at how traditional estimation works. An estimator (who you pay a very healthy salary) spends hours or days staring at 2D blueprints, using a mouse to click and drag over perimeters to calculate square footage, linear runs, and material counts.
It's slow. It's tedious. And because humans get tired, it's highly prone to error. If your estimator misses a load-bearing wall or miscalculates the required concrete yardage, your margin is already bleeding before you've even won the bid. Worse, because the process is so slow, you can only bid on a limited number of projects per month.

The Best AI Tools for Construction Estimation
The immediate goal is to turn days of manual takeoff work into seconds. This isn't science fiction; it's what your most profitable competitors are already doing.
1. Togal.AI (Automated Takeoffs) If you are still doing manual takeoffs, you are throwing money away. Tools like Togal.AI use deep machine learning to automatically analyze architectural drawings. You upload the plans, and the AI instantly maps out rooms, walls, doors, and square footage. It categorizes spaces and generates incredibly accurate material quantities in seconds.
The Penny Perspective: Think about what this does for your business. Your estimators go from being "data-entry clerks who click on screens" to actual strategic reviewers. You can bid on 5x more projects with the exact same headcount.
2. Procore AI (Predictive Risk & Project Management) Procore has integrated AI deeply into its platform. Its real power is in predictive risk. The AI scans your daily logs, RFIs (Requests for Information), and change orders to flag projects that are trending toward a margin disaster. It reads the tone of emails between your project managers and subs, alerting you to escalating disputes before they turn into expensive legal delays.
3. Document Parsing AI (Doxel / Document Crunch) Construction is drowning in paper: 300-page contracts, compliance forms, safety regulations. Tools like Document Crunch use AI specifically trained on construction law to review contracts. It flags risky clauses, unusual payment terms, and hidden liabilities in minutes. You don't need a lawyer to do the first pass anymore.
Taming the Supply Chain & Site Operations
A flawless estimate means nothing if your materials arrive three weeks late while your site crew sits idle on full pay.
Supply chain chaos has been the default state of construction since 2020. But the businesses that are thriving right now have stopped relying on "calling the supplier to check." They use AI predictive scheduling.
Modern AI supply chain tools ingest global shipping data, local weather patterns, and historical supplier performance. If the AI sees that the specific type of steel you ordered is currently delayed at ports 60% of the time, it alerts you weeks in advance, allowing you to source an alternative or re-sequence your site schedule so labour isn't wasted.

Eliminating Administrative Delays & Equipment Waste
Take a hard look at your non-labour site costs. How much of your heavy machinery is currently sitting idle on a site, racking up rental fees or depreciation, simply because a site manager forgot to off-hire it?
AI telematics platforms now track equipment utilisation automatically. If an excavator hasn't been turned on in 72 hours, the AI automatically pings the site manager asking if it should be returned or moved to another site. It removes human forgetfulness from the equation entirely. The 30-Day AI Implementation Playbook
I know how overwhelming this can sound. Construction owners are busy, stressed, and constantly putting out fires. The idea of implementing "AI transformation" feels like a luxury you don't have time for.
But you don't need to rebuild the entire company overnight. You just need to start. Here is your playbook for the next 30 days:
Step 1: Audit Your Takeoffs Ask your estimating team how many hours they spent on manual takeoffs last week. Calculate the financial cost of those hours. Then, sign up for a free trial of an AI takeoff tool. Run a parallel test: have an estimator do it the traditional way, and run the same plans through the AI. Compare the accuracy and the time. The numbers will make the decision for you.
Step 2: Automate the Inbox Set up an AI tool (even something as accessible as ChatGPT Plus or Claude) to act as a document assistant for your project managers. Train them to drop lengthy RFIs or sub-contractor updates into the AI to extract action items instantly, rather than spending two hours reading them.
Step 3: Question Every Admin Hire Before you approve the next job requisition for a "Project Administrator" or "Junior Estimator," ask yourself: Am I hiring a human to act as a bridge between two pieces of software? If the answer is yes, an AI automation can do it faster, cheaper, and without needing a pension plan.
